Read More »In recognition of the change in program scope and delivery, the office of Student Life will become the office of student involvement on Sunday, July 1. Located in the Student Involvement Center on the second floor of Havener Center, the student involvement staff aims to connect students to community, develop engaged leaders and create a culture of mentorship to enhance personal and professional development.
